Lora Bryning Redford Post-Doctoral Fellowship in Archaeology
University of Puget Sound Tacoma, WA
University of Puget Sound Lora Bryning Redford Post-Doctoral Fellowship in Archaeology Job ID: 8546 Location: History Full/Part Time:   Regular/Tempoary:   Faculty Posting Details Appointment: The University of Puget Sound Invites applications for the Lora Bryning Redford Post-Doctoral Fellowship in Archaeology starting in Fall 2026. This is a nonrenewable one-year position. Responsibilities: The Redford Fellow will be expected to teach four undergraduate courses over the year: an introduction to archaeology (including archaeological methods) course and an elective in their area of specialization in the fall and two more specialized courses in the spring, chosen in consultation with the faculty mentor.
